Output 2915b774a5bb430195cc4c96958553c0d3dff77bfa0e2917999146d281b7591a:12

value
637583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45bc01eeab073a7dce39922578819773c89d29e9 OP_EQUALVERIFY OP_CHECKSIG
address
17MirEKsELqpcWsQk4cToXr2zwxGdicEaY
transaction
2915b774a5bb430195cc4c96958553c0d3dff77bfa0e2917999146d281b7591a
confirmations
305079
spent
true